Alpha testing is the initial phase of testing performed on a software application before it is released to a larger audience or undergoes beta testing. this internal testing phase serves as your software's first real world examination, conducted within your development environment by your own team members. Alpha testing is one of the earliest forms of software testing after initial development is complete but prior to it reaching external users' hands. in general, it takes place in a controlled environment at the hands of internal team members who are independent from the development process. Little user engagement: alpha testers are few in number and frequently comprise members of the development team or those intimately connected to the project. environment: alpha testing is typically carried out in a development environment or laboratory that resembles actual settings. what is beta testing?.
